Senior Nurse Anesthetist Salary in Missoula, MT: $324,416 (2026)

Quick Answer:The top tier of nurse anesthetists working in Missoula, MT — those at or above the 90th percentile — pull in $324,416/year or more for 2026, based on BLS OEWS 2025 estimates for SOC 29-1151. Strip back Missoula's price premium (BEA RPP 96.2, 4% below national) and that top-decile pay carries the same buying power as $337,231 in average-cost America. The 44% spread above city median typically rewards 7+ years of practice or specialty credentials.

Maximizing Your Nurse Anesthetist Earnings in Missoula

Effective compensation strategies for experienced nurse anesthetists in Missoula hinge on several factors, including specialization and employer type. Those working in high-demand areas such as trauma centers and pain management clinics can command premium pay, especially if they possess advanced credentials like the Doctor of Nursing Practice (DNP) or specialty fellowships. The choice of employer significantly influences earning potential; for example, CRNA-owned group practices often provide partnership tracks that feature profit-sharing, while hospital systems may offer benefits such as weekend and holiday differentials. Additionally, alternative pathways in the form of locum tenens opportunities or faculty positions allow for flexibility and often higher pay depending on the demand. The landscape for senior nurse anesthetists also supports growth opportunities into leadership positions, where strategic influence within an anesthesia department can further propel income growth through various incentive structures and bonuses associated with operational efficiency and quality of care delivery.
